Lorena Isceri was still alive when she was thrown from the viaduct: what the autopsy said and the old quarrel recounted by the mother

FLORENCE. Lorena Isceri, the 45-year-old woman killed by her ex-partner Federico Vella on the afternoon of Thursday, September 3rd in Florence, was still alive when she was thrown off a viaduct of the A1 highway in Barberino del Mugello. This emerges from the first results of the autopsy started yesterday in Florence, and it is what the investigators of the Mobile Squad and the prosecutor Antonio Natale expected given what emerged in the first days of investigation.

The investigations

Irrepeatable technical investigations were entrusted to doctors Elisa Ferri and Beatrice Defraia. The report will be filed within 90 days. The two professionals were asked to clarify whether the 45-year-old was still alive when she was thrown from the viaduct and to verify the possible presence of injuries attributable to a previous phase.

Vella’s body, who killed himself by throwing himself from the same viaduct half an hour after throwing down his ex-partner, was also subjected to an autopsy and to toxicological tests to verify whether the man had taken drugs or psychotropic medications.

The video

Investigators now seem convinced that Lorena was alive until she was thrown off the viaduct: supporting this is also a video from the highway security cameras as well as the recording of the call that the woman managed to make to 112 from the trunk of the car in which Vella had locked her. Similarly, Lorena’s mother reportedly told investigators about a furious argument at her daughter’s house in which the ex-partner was violent towards her.

The inquiries

Meanwhile, the Prosecutor’s Office has also opened a file for kidnapping in order to commit murder, and femicide aggravated by premeditation. The man was reportedly seen by some neighbors wandering around the area of Isceri’s home, in via Panciatichi in Rifredi. Also under review by the Mobile Squad is the receipt of a purchase made by the man on the morning of the crime in a shop in Novoli, and the material found in the car, including cable ties, hammer, scissors, adhesive tape, and a tarp. Objects that could have been used by Vella to prepare the ambush on his ex in her home garage and to kidnap her. Natale also ordered a forensic copy of the three seized cell phones to reconstruct what happened in the weeks before the femicide, from when Lorena Isceri decided to end the relationship.

The funeral

After the medico-legal investigations, already tomorrow (September 8) Lorena’s body could be returned to the family and then transported to Squinzano, her hometown, where the funeral will be held tomorrow or Thursday, on the occasion of which the mayor, Mario Pede, has announced a day of mourning.

After the appeal of father Franco

Meanwhile, the appeal of Franco Isceri, Lorena’s father, addressed to the institutions is achieving a first concrete result. Educating to respect and equality from the earliest years of school, training teachers and providing them with tools to recognize and deconstruct gender stereotypes. This is the goal of the national project “Educating to gender equality from childhood,” promoted by the University of Florence and the Giulia Cecchettin Foundation ets, which the Region has joined and which will be presented on Tuesday the 15th at the Sala Pegaso of Palazzo Strozzi Sacrati with the regional councilor for Equal Opportunities Cristina Manetti and the president of the foundation, Gino Cecchettin, together with representatives of the university.
